Python 网络爬虫:一步步构建你的爬虫116
网络爬虫,也称为网络蜘蛛,是自动化浏览网页并提取信息的程序。Python 作为一门强大的编程语言,提供了丰富的库和模块,使其成为开发网络爬虫的理想选择。
本文将引导你逐步构建一个简单的 Python 网络爬虫,该爬虫可以从网页中提取特定信息。我们还将探讨网络爬虫背后的概念和最佳实践。
步骤 1:导入必要的库import requests
from bs4 import BeautifulSoup
开始之前,你需要导入以下库:
requests 用于发送 HTTP 请求和获取网页。
BeautifulSoup 用于解析 HTML。
步骤 2:发送 HTTP 请求url = ''
response = (url)
使用 requests 库向目标 URL 发送 GET 请求。response 包含服务器返回的完整 HTTP 响应。
步骤 3:解析 HTMLsoup = BeautifulSoup(, '')
使用 BeautifulSoup 解析 HTML。soup 现在是一个包含 HTML 文档结构的 BeautifulSoup 对象。
步骤 4:提取特定信息
PHP正确获取MySQL中文数据:从乱码到清晰的完整指南
https://www.shuihudhg.cn/132249.html
Java集合到数组:深度解析转换机制、类型安全与性能优化
https://www.shuihudhg.cn/132248.html
现代Java代码简化艺术:告别冗余,拥抱优雅与高效
https://www.shuihudhg.cn/132247.html
Python文件读写性能深度优化:从原理到实践
https://www.shuihudhg.cn/132246.html
Python文件传输性能优化:深入解析耗时瓶颈与高效策略
https://www.shuihudhg.cn/132245.html
热门文章
Python 格式化字符串
https://www.shuihudhg.cn/1272.html
Python 函数库:强大的工具箱,提升编程效率
https://www.shuihudhg.cn/3366.html
Python向CSV文件写入数据
https://www.shuihudhg.cn/372.html
Python 静态代码分析:提升代码质量的利器
https://www.shuihudhg.cn/4753.html
Python 文件名命名规范:最佳实践
https://www.shuihudhg.cn/5836.html